For the last year I have been fighting UHC with bilaterial eye injections and how they are billed. With CMS we bill two lines of the medication with modifier JZRT/JZLT and then it it paid. UHC has at one point told us and other offices they want the J code on one line with the JZ50 modifiers and then change the amount of units. We started doing that and then it was denied stating invalid use of JZ modifier. Then we were told they want two lines with just JZ on one and JW on the other. The problem with that is we do not waste any of this medication so the use of the JW modifier is not valid. Then I was recently told to resubmit all bilateral eye injections on one line with just JZ modifier not eye modifier or modifier 50, change units and bill. WEll I did that and they are starting to be denied. I have filed another case with the provider relations department with UHC.
